César Bozal Germán is one of the most influential figures in the Spanish knife world. His passion began early, evolving over decades into deep expertise regarding materials, ergonomics, and design. He has worked for renowned collectors, hunters, and chefs, designed knives for prestigious brands, and—as president of the ACAE (Association of Artisan Knifemakers of Spain)—left an indelible mark on the industry.

Materials:
Blade: VG-10 stainless steel.
Handle: G10.
Lock System: back lock.
Measurements:
Blade: 57 mm.
Overall: 137 mm.
Closed: 80 mm.
Tickness: 2.5 mm.
Weight: 42 grs.
